中文 | English
一个现代化的贪吃蛇游戏,使用HTML5 Canvas和JavaScript开发。
左:游戏开始界面 | 右:游戏进行中
- 经典玩法: 控制蛇吃食物,避免撞墙和撞到自己
- 现代界面: 美观的渐变背景和圆角设计
- 响应式设计: 支持桌面端和移动端
- 多种控制方式:
- 键盘控制:WASD 或方向键
- 移动端触摸按钮
- 游戏功能:
- 实时计分系统
- 最高分记录(本地存储)
- 暂停/继续功能
- 游戏结束重新开始
- 直接在浏览器中打开
index.html文件 - 点击"开始游戏"按钮
- 使用键盘或触摸按钮控制蛇的移动
-
移动控制:
- 桌面端:使用 WASD 键或方向键
- 移动端:点击屏幕上的方向按钮
-
游戏目标:
- 控制蛇吃红色的食物
- 每吃一个食物得10分
- 蛇会变长一节
-
游戏结束条件:
- 蛇撞到墙壁
- 蛇撞到自己的身体
-
特殊功能:
- 暂停:点击暂停按钮或游戏进行中按空格键
- 重新开始:游戏结束后点击重新开始按钮
- 前端技术: HTML5, CSS3, JavaScript (ES6+)
- 图形渲染: HTML5 Canvas API
- 数据存储: localStorage (最高分记录)
- 响应式设计: CSS媒体查询
- 兼容性: 现代浏览器 (Chrome, Firefox, Safari, Edge)
游戏完全支持移动设备:
- 触摸控制按钮
- 响应式布局
- 适配不同屏幕尺寸
- 渐变背景色彩
- 圆角卡片式设计
- 现代化按钮样式
- 清晰的游戏网格
- 平滑的动画效果
- 基础游戏功能实现
- 桌面端和移动端支持
- 计分系统和最高分记录
- 暂停/继续功能
- 现代化UI设计
欢迎提交问题和改进建议!
MIT License - 可自由使用和修改

